26 Aug USD/JPY Daily
Faltered at the 104.49 high and setback seen unwinding strong upmove last week. Bounce from the 103.86 low to regain the 104.00 level see resistance now at 104.19 then the 104.49 high. While the latter caps risk is seen for stronger correction, lower see more support at 103.50 then the 103.09/00 area. [P.L]

R5:: 105.05 * trendline from Aug 98 R4: 104.84/92 * 23, 16 Jan highs
R3: 104.65/70 congestion
R2: 104.49 25 Aug high
R1: 104.19 22 Aug high

S1: 103.86 25 Aug low
S2: 103.50 * 22 Aug low
S3: 103.09/00 * 30 Jul high, figure
S4: 102.72 15 Aug high
S5: 102.45 200-day MA
